To plan a multi-city brand awareness campaign, you must align digital advertising, physical out-of-home (OOH) advertising, and unique events. Combining these marketing strategies helps you achieve maximum visibility and expand your reach. The following steps can help you plan a successful multi-city campaign:
1. Set Measurable Goals
Selecting goals with localized key performance indicators (KPIs), such as the following, can help you measure campaign success:
Social media reach
QR code scan rates
Online advertisement click rates
Increase in website visits
On-site engagement numbers at events
Product sampling volumes
Number of brand ambassador interactions
2. Define Target Audience Based on Location
Culture, weather, values, and local competition vary by location. Defining your target audience in each city can help you tailor messaging, activities, and visuals to boost conversions. For example, individuals in a large metropolitan area might appreciate efficiency-focused messaging, while consumers in smaller, rural areas might respond better to community-oriented messaging.
3. Plan Your Advertising Methods
Next, plan a diverse mix of advertising methods to reach your target audience in each city. Here are some of the most effective marketing strategies for multi-city campaigns:
OOH Vehicle Wraps

OOH vehicle wraps are a mobile, high-impact, and cost-efficient marketing method for multi-city marketing. Wrapping rideshare vehicles and specialty cars with your brand messaging gives you 24/7 visibility across multiple regions. A wrapped vehicle acts as a moving billboard for your brand.
Events and Experiential Moments
Special events and experiential moments are opportunities for consumers to sample your product and interact with your brand. You can also use these opportunities to partner with brand ambassadors, help your content go viral and boost your social media presence. Consider offering VIP rides, handing out branded swag, or scheduling a roadshow to capture attention in highly populated areas.
Social Media Advertisements
You can personalize social media advertisements, sending targeted ads to users based on demographics such as age and location. For example, you might set an ad about an upcoming event or roadshow to reach users within a 10-mile radius of the event's location.
Localized Search Advertisements
You can run search ads or optimize your content to organically appear in results pages when users search for specific products or services near them. Create location pages on your website, and use location-based keywords to help your content rank in search engine results pages (SERPs).
